What You Will Learn
Define the core characteristics of high-performing teams versus working groups.
Experience the impact of non-verbal communication and information loss in real-time.
Identify personal strengths and potential blind spots within a team context.
Develop strategies to overcome the 'Hero Syndrome' and improve delegation.
Apply the principles of psychological safety to encourage open dialogue.
Practice the art of constructive conflict to resolve disagreements effectively.
Create a personal commitment to specific behavioural changes for the workplace.
Establish a framework for sustaining team performance post-training.
